Re: [IRCA] Wellbrook Large Aperture Loop Antenna ALA100LN
My understanding from Andrew Ikin was that a loop 
considerably different in size from that for 
which the amplifier is designed, creates an 
impedance mismatch that eats into the gain that 
is available from the amplifier.
